Overview

VSE Corporation engages in providing aviation aftermarket parts distribution and maintenance, repair, and overhaul services for air transportation assets for commercial and government markets. It offers its services to global client base of commercial airlines, regional airlines, air cargo transporters, MRO integrators and providers, aviation manufacturers, corporate and private aircraft owners, and fixed-base operators. The company was incorporated in 1959 and is headquartered in Miramar, Florida.
